Могу ли я заставить Sublime Text автоматически запускать другую команду после загрузки плагина Sublime SFTP?

Могу ли я заставить Sublime Text автоматически запускать другую команду после того, как плагин Sublime SFTP выполнит загрузку? Может быть, это может вызвать команду терминала или системную службу (которую я настроил с помощью Automator OSX)?

Это то, что я специально пытаюсь сделать ... У меня есть Sublime SFTP, настроенный на автоматическую загрузку при сохранении. У меня также есть системная служба, которая перезагружает активную вкладку в Safari. Мне бы хотелось, чтобы нажатие CMD-S для сохранения не только загружало, но и перезагружало активную вкладку браузера после завершения загрузки. Есть ли способ запустить команду после завершения загрузки плагина SFTP?

Заранее спасибо!


person Jesse Leite    schedule 20.02.2014    source источник


Ответы (1)


Здесь есть несколько вариантов:

  1. Существуют плагины, поддерживающие предварительный просмотр в реальном времени или обновление при сохранении. Например, https://sublime.wbond.net/search/Refresh или LiveReload

  2. Плагин Chain of Command позволяет последовательно выполнять несколько команд.

person adibender    schedule 22.02.2014
comment
Я попробовал LiveReload, и он работает... хотя, если мне нужно дождаться загрузки, я должен установить задержку, чтобы браузер обновлялся после загрузки. Я балуюсь с Chain of Command... спасибо за рекомендацию. Я думаю, это правильный путь :) Знаете ли вы, поддерживает ли Chain of Command аргументы команд? - person Jesse Leite; 23.02.2014
comment
Если вы посмотрите на файл readme для пакета Browser Refresh, при настройке привязки клавиш вы можете передать в качестве аргумента в команду browser_refresh activ_browser: true/false. Моя самая большая проблема с этим рабочим процессом сейчас заключается в том, что когда я использую Chain of Command и Browser Refresh вместе, он по умолчанию устанавливает фокус на моем браузере. Если бы я мог передать этот аргументactivate_browser:false в Chain of Command, я был бы очень счастлив :) - person Jesse Leite; 24.02.2014
comment
@JerseyMilker Вы пытались установить "activate_browser": false по умолчанию в своих пользовательских настройках? - person adibender; 25.02.2014